by Ellen Datlow
First published 2011
A professional killer eliminates targets through orchestrated accidents. A detective finds himself trapped between competing supernatural realms. A man conceals monstrous hungers beneath an even more sinister truth. These characters populate twenty original stories where criminal underworlds collide with otherworldly forces. Hugo and Bram Stoker Award winner Ellen Datlow curates tales from masters including Brian Evenson, Joe R. Lansdale, Caitlín R. Kiernan, Nick Mamatas, Gregory Frost, and Jeffrey Ford. Each story explores how supernatural elements infiltrate noir scenarios, creating narratives where external mysteries mirror internal darkness. The collection examines characters caught between mundane criminal enterprises and paranormal threats, forcing them to navigate dangers both human and inhuman.
